
The burial date for the World Men’s Marathon record holder Kelvin Kiptum has been changed from the initial date of February 24 to February 23 due to President William Ruto’s change of diary.
This move was made to enable President William Ruto to attend Kiptum’s burial after the Kenyan government took over to accord him state funeral in his home village in Chepkorioon, Elgeyo Marakwet County.
The President was planning to attend Kiptum’s funeral on the former date but it clashed with the state funeral of the late Namibian president Hage Geingob, which he plans to attend. Geingob’s state funeral will be held on February 24, ahead of his interment on Sunday, February 25. President William Ruto will fly out of the country on Saturday
